Johnny Blood McNally Life story
John Victor McNally, nicknamed "Johnny Blood", was an American football player and coach. McNally was named a member of the NFL 1930s All-Decade Team and was inducted into the Pro Football Hall of Fame as a player in 1963, as one of the Hall of Fame's 17 charter members.
